SGM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review
37 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Stonegate Mortgage Corporation (SGM)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$39.2M — down 45% from $71.3M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 18 funds closed out of SGM and 11 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 13 trimmed existing stakes and 10 added.
The largest buyer was 683 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.65M. The largest seller was SG Americas Securities, exiting entirely with an estimated $3.13M sold.
